During three marriages, which brought her to California, by way of the Carolinas, she found her truest loves: her daughters, Janice Lynn and Kathleen, along with the many grandkids, and great grandkids that followed.
She was a long term employee of Hamilton Instrumentation near her home in Hacienda Heights. As a regional sales rep she fostered many working relationships to the long term benefit of the company
Throughout her working years, and into retirement, she was rarely without canine companionship. She was especially fond of her cockapoo, Charlie.
In her golden years she enjoyed frequent travel, which brought her into the depths of Europe, to the shores of Africa, and the sandy beaches of Belize. Despite life's challenges, she managed to encounter joyous occasions with family and friends.
